HTML HELPERS IN ASP.NET MVC - AN OVERVIEW

html helpers in asp.net mvc - An Overview

html helpers in asp.net mvc - An Overview

Blog Article

Typically, type controls come with validation messages, tooltips, and unique CSS kinds. In lieu of repeating the exact same construction, a customized HTML helper can encapsulate this sample. Instance: An enter discipline that immediately shows validation problems next to it

Let's create a Custom HTML Helper to render an enter with validation characteristics. So, make a course file Using the identify FormControlHelpers.cs within the Styles folder and copy and paste the following code.

The commented sample code higher than demonstrates how you'll substitute the lambda expression While using the @ operator to accessibility Each and every ToDoItem in the listing.

We have to populate the ProfileCardModel from our controller and send out it to the check out. So, modify the house Controller course as follows.

Distinction between and tag of HTML The and tags in HTML the two style text as italic, but they serve different uses. The tag is used for Visible styling with out semantic indicating, although conveys emphasis and provides semantic significance, improving upon accessibility and that means in content. Notice: The

Produce breadcrumb navigation based on the furnished list of paths. So, make a class file While using the title BreadcrumbHelpers.cs within the Types folder and copy and paste the next code.

The RadioButton helper technique renders a radio button. In its simplest sort, the strategy takes a few parameters: the title of the Regulate group, the choice worth, along with a Boolean benefit that decides whether or not the radio button is selected initially. The subsequent markup exhibits markup with the RadioButton helper strategy.

We are able to use this HTML helper to outline the DropDownLisT() listing. This can be the loosely typed extension system functionality which we can easily determine as a DropDownList() element in razor see with a particular name, together with checklist products and HTML attributes.

Tag Helpers Keep to the organic HTML move, leading to cleaner and more maintainable Razor sights, specially when working with elaborate kinds or UI factors.

We will use this HTML.RadioButton() Helper technique utilizing the course to define the HTML features. Here is the loosely typed growth strategy perform which we are able to define as enter variety to select the () ingredient in razor look at.

Adds the HTML5 knowledge-valmsg-for="residence" attribute to the span component, which attaches the validation error messages within the input discipline of the desired design residence. Every time a shopper facet validation error occurs, jQuery displays the mistake information in the factor.

HTML Helpers: Generating custom made HTML Helpers requires defining static strategies that return HTML strings. This can be less intuitive and might involve additional exertion to handle complicated output or include context-informed logic.

The HtmlHelper course renders HTML controls in the razor watch. It binds the model object to HTML controls to Display screen the value of design properties into All those controls and also assigns the value of your controls for the product properties even though publishing a web kind. So normally use the HtmlHelper class in razor watch rather than composing HTML tags manually.

An HTML Helper is simply html helpers in asp.net mvc a technique that returns a string. The string can signify any type of material you want.

Report this page